The person can undergo the Reversal Surgery - Tube Reconstruction Surgery.

But the success rates for conceiving after the Tube Reconstruction is very Less if the Tubes were burnt and clipped in the regions other than Isthmus.

There is a High risk of Ectopic Pregnancy after the Tube Reconstruction Surgery which may sometimes be very dangerous.
